Seed heads of Kentucky 31 tall fescue present special risks when fed to cattle. As seed heads emerge, toxic alkaloids concentrate in the seed. K-31 is the most widely used grass in Missouri pastures.
Why would we want to think about transitioning some of our pastures to a novel endophyte tall fescue instead of keeping it in Kentucky 31 tall fescue? The main reason is because of fescue toxicosis.
